Web11 jan. 2024 · What soft contact lenses are made of. Soft contacts are made of pliable hydrophilic ("water-loving") plastics called hydrogels. Hydrogels absorb significant amounts of water to keep the lenses soft and supple. Because of this water-loving characteristic, the water content of various hydrogel contact lenses can range from approximately 38 to 75 ... WebThe hydrogel in the lenses is either ionic or non-ionic. Non-ionic hydrogel soft contacts tend to attract fewer proteins, which means there’s less chance of buildup. 1992: Tinted disposables (first soft contacts with colour) …
